> I reviewed this thread and realized you haven't gotten anywhere.
> Unfortunately, reassembly of your array is not likely to be automatic.
> Raid10 in default form cannot tolerate adjacent failures, so the fact
> that you lack indices 1 & 2 suggest your data is lost.
>
> More, very detailed data will be needed.  Please start with the complete
> output of "mdadm -E" for all of the affected partitions, "smartctl -x"
> for all of the drives they're on, and if you have it, a copy of the LVM
> backup file that describes that part of your system.
